Sumario:Exploring age, intergenerational relationships, and the social power of reputation across ancient Mediterranean cultural contexts, Honouring Age positions age as an essential aspect of communal identity and familial roles in the early Christian experience as represented in one of the most contentious texts in the New Testament, 1 Timothy.
Cover -- HONOURING AGE -- Title -- Copyright -- Dedication -- Contents -- Table and Figures -- Acknowledgments -- A Note on Ancient Sources -- 1 Why Study Age in 1 Timothy? -- 2 Mediterranean Dynamics of Age Structure and 1 Timothy -- 3 One Letter, Two Stories: Rhetoric and Crisis -- 4 Ideal Behaviour in the "Household of God" (1 Tim. 5:1-2) -- 5 Categorizing Widows: Definitions and Responsibilities -- 6 Why Sixty? -- 7 Younger Widows and Age Hierarchy among Women -- 8 A Believing Woman -- 9 Elders -- 10 Intergenerational Conflict in 1 Timothy: The Big Picture -- 11 The Visibility of Age -- Notes -- References -- Index.
